How He Actually Stays in That Shape
So, how does he do it? Most of us would be thrilled to have half his energy.
Basically, he hasn't stopped moving since the 1960s. He told The Healthy that his philosophy is pretty simple: "A body that keeps moving, moves, and one that stops, stops." It sounds like something a coach would scream at you, but he actually lives it.
- The Total Gym Factor: He’s been the face of Total Gym for what feels like forever. He didn't just do the commercials for the paycheck; he actually uses the thing. He started using it in 1976 to rehab a rotator cuff injury and never stopped.
- The Pool Workouts: This is the part most people don't know. In 2023, he shared that he’s been doing his martial arts "forms" (katas) in the swimming pool. The water provides resistance but is way easier on his joints.
- The "Morning Kick": He and Gena launched a supplement line called Roundhouse Provisions. He swears by a morning routine involving ashwagandha and other "superfoods."

The Agent Recon Era
2023 wasn't just about gym selfies. It was the year he actually went back to work on a movie set.

He spent a good chunk of the year filming Agent Recon, a sci-fi action flick that eventually came out in 2024. This was a big deal because he hadn’t done a proper action movie since The Expendables 2 back in 2012.
His son, Dakota Norris, actually choreographed the fights. Imagine being the guy who has to tell Chuck Norris how to punch. That takes some serious guts. Dakota made sure the choreography played to Chuck’s strengths while acknowledging that, yeah, he’s in his eighties. But if you see the stills from that production, he’s wearing tactical gear and holding heavy prop weapons like he never left.

The Legacy of the 2023 Look
Looking at those 2023 pictures, you realize he has successfully transitioned from "Action Star" to "Living Legend."
He doesn't have to prove anything anymore. He has black belts in Tang Soo Do, Brazilian Jiu-Jitsu, and Judo. He even created his own system, Chun Kuk Do. The pictures we saw that year weren't about vanity; they were about a guy who refused to let "old age" be a personality trait.
